VISTA MIDDLE is a 6-8 campus of well-populated scale in LAS CRUCES, New Mexico, run under LAS CRUCES, serveing 574 students in grades 6 through 8. That puts it 71% larger than the typical public school in New Mexico, which averages around 335 students.
VISTA MIDDLE is one of 39 schools operated by LAS CRUCES, a district that instructs 22,670 students overall.
In terms of who attends, VISTA MIDDLE logs that 86% of students identify as Hispanic, making the school strongly Hispanic-majority. Other groups include 9% White. That is noticeably more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 68%.
Looking at school resources, On paper, VISTA MIDDLE has 56 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 10.3: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 12.5:1 average. Roughly 100% of students at VISTA MIDDLE q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y.
With demographic context factored in, VISTA MIDDLE t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 33.4%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 33.6%.
In the broader community, Doñan Ana County reports that the typical household earns roughly $56,848 per year, about 32%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and roughly 19% of residents live below the federal poverty line. VISTA MIDDLE is one of 81 public schools in Doñan Ana County (combined enrollment of about 36,561 students).
COLUMBIA ELEMENTARY is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.3 miles from this campus.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. On composite proficiency, VISTA MIDDLE comes 6th of 8 in the immediate cluster, behind the nearby-schools average of 37.5%.
The campus sits in a city-core setting.
Five-year trend. Over the past 7-year window, the student count ticked down 19%: 713 students in 2018 compared to 574 in 2025. The White share of enrollment decreased from 15% to 9% over that span. Class-load math has fell: from 18.0:1 in 2018 to 10.3:1 in 2025.
